I applied online with a referral and had a phone screen within a week. The phone screen was positive, the HR person was very nice and the information was very transparent - she talked a lot about the company, the role and discussed the salary as well. I then had an in-person interview a few days later with the manager of the team and her. The interview started with a tour of the building, and then I sat down with the manager. He didn't really ask me any normal interview questions, which I thought was weird. He was more interested in what I was looking for and where I was currently interviewing. Overall I felt very confident after the interview, so I was surprised when I did not get invited to the job shadow (final stage of interview process). I asked for feedback and the response I got was "it's our company policy that we do not disclose those specific details with our candidates", which I found to be rather insulting and honestly a huge red flag.
